Tomodachi Life: Living the Dream has been out for about a week now, so fans have had a little bit of time to really dig into Nintendo’s newest life sim. With a Top Critic Average of 80 on OpenCritic, the game has been very well-received for its sense of humor and customization options. The number of new events that can happen between Miis as they run around town and develop their own relationships, combined with all the drama that entails, make Tomodachi Life: Living the Dream downright addictive to play. However, despite all the drama Miis can spark through their interactions, some fans feel like Miis seem too “nice” to each other sometimes.
